No, dark urine can be a sign of infection, blood in your urine or just a sign that you are not drinking enough water. Try increasing your liquids with water or juice, stay away from soda, coffee/tea and alcohol. See if this helps, if your urine stays dark or you are having pain when you urinate or unusual low back pain, see your health care provider.

The reason they want you to take it in the morning is that the urine is more concentrated, meaning the hormone that is detected by the test is in greater quantity in the morning urine and will show positive or negative more correctly.
